Panasonic Energy Corporation of North America (PECNA) is collaborating with Tesla Motors, Inc. in a large-scale advanced battery manufacturing facility known as the Gigafactory near Reno, Nevada which is known for its quality of life and expansive outdoor adventures. Panasonic manufactures and supplies cylindrical lithium-ion cells for the world's leading electric vehicle manufacturer, Tesla Motors, Inc. Based on the battery demand from Tesla, the Gigafactory plans to produce cells which will double the world's current production.

Our mission at PECNA is to make the vision of affordable Electric Vehicles a reality by production of the world's safest, highest-quality, and lowest-cost batteries. Through this effort we will create a clean energy society and our products will change society's use of and perceptions of electric power.

Essential Duties:
  • Ensure that all projects are delivered on-time, within scope and within budget
  • Manage the overall scopes of various projects.
  • Manage and control project budget, track actual cost vs budgeted cost, forecast anticipated costs, create daily or weekly cost reports, etc.
  • Control and manage project documentation including issuing contracts, change orders, request for information (RFI), drawing/design packages, design change narratives (DCN), etc.
  • Schedule entire scope of project including all related departments. Track Critical path of project including recovery schedules and areas of schedule improvement.
  • Ability to lead and direct project meetings utilizing the schedule and other project related documentation.
  • Measure project performance using appropriate tools and techniques
  • Perform risk management to minimize project risks
  • Create daily or weekly construction reports including major highlights, schedule updates, current project status, issues or conflicts, and next action plans.
  • Develop spreadsheets, diagrams and process maps to document needs
  • Ability to prioritize a list of many projects and execute project deliverables with available resources.
  • Provides input on process improvement opportunities.
  • Other duties as assigned.

About Panasonic

Panasonic Corporation is a multinational electronics company based in Osaka, Japan. The company was founded in 1918 as Matsushita Electric Industrial Co., Ltd. and changed its name to Panasonic Corporation in 2008. Panasonic produces a wide range of products, including televisions, home appliances, cameras, audio equipment, and automotive electronics. The company also provides business solutions, such as security systems, communication systems, and energy solutions. Panasonic has operations in over 160 countries and employs over 259,000 people.
